The first chapter contains a review of fluid and rock properties. Several new correlations are presented in this chapter that will assist those doing computer modeling. Chapter 2 contains a development of the general material balance equation. The next four chapters present information on the different reservoir types which the original text treated in the first four chap¬ters. New material has been added in several places throughout these four chapters. Chapter 7 presents a discussion of one phase fluid flow. The radial diffusivity equation is derived and pressure transient analysis is introduced. Chapter 8 contains new material on water influx. Both edgewater and bottom- water drives are discussed. Chapter 9 is an update of the original Chapter 7 but also contains some new material on waterflooding and enhanced oil recovery techniques. Chapter 10 is a new chapter 011 history matching. This is a concept to which each reservoir engineer should have some exposure. The approach taken in the chapter is to provide an example of a history match by combining the Schilthuis material balance equation with a fluid flow equation.
